Plaatjie murder case in Limbo as PG yet to decide on prosecution

Breadcrumb

11 months ago By NBC Online

The murder case of 31-year-old Keetmanshoop resident Elleste Plaatjie remains in limbo, as the Office of the Prosecutor General has yet to decide whether to prosecute two police officers accused in his death.

Judgement in Van Wyk Fishrot Case postponed to May 9

Breadcrumb

11 months ago By NBC Online

The Windhoek High Court has postponed its judgement in the application by Fishrot accused Nigel van Wyk, who is seeking to have nine charges against him dismissed.
